Lackland Laundry and Linen
Solicitation # HT940826QE029
The Defense Health Agency is soliciting a firm-fixed-price contract for medical-grade bulk laundry and dry-cleaning services to support the Wilford Hall Ambulatory Surgical Center and outlying clinics at Joint Base San Antonio Lackland and Randolph, Texas. This 100 percent small business set-aside under NAICS 812320 requires a contractor to provide all personnel, equipment, and transportation for various services, including bulk medical laundry, microfiber processing, special item laundry for lab coats and clinical linens, specialized stain washes, and separate veterinary laundry for the Holland Military Working Dogs Hospital. The base period runs from September 30, 2026, to September 29, 2027, with an option period extending to March 29, 2028. Contractors must adhere to strict quality and infection control standards established by the CDC, OSHA, and the Healthcare Laundry Accreditation Council, including the maintenance of specific air pressure boundaries in processing facilities. Award will be based on a best-value comparative tradeoff between price and past performance confidence, provided the offeror passes a technical capability screening. Proposals must be submitted in four separate searchable PDF volumes by September 21, 2026. Key requirements include a detailed transition plan for a medically cleared workforce, adherence to Service Contract Act wage determinations, and the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ing.

Laundry Services
Solicitation # FA665626Q0017
Solicitation FA665626Q0017 is a request for quotations for a single firm-fixed price blanket purchase agreement to provide commercial laundry and chemical gear cleaning services for the 910th Airlift Wing at Youngstown Air Reserve Station in Vienna, Ohio. The scope of work includes the pickup, laundering, dry cleaning, and delivery of items, with estimated annual quantities of 53,000 pounds for general laundry and 1,600 pounds for chemical gear cleaning over a five-year period from October 1, 2026, through September 30, 2031. The contractor is responsible for providing all personnel, equipment, and supplies, ensuring adherence to industry quality standards and state or local health regulations, and following a specific pickup and delivery schedule across various base locations. The acquisition is open for full competition under NAICS code 812320, with a small business size standard of 8 million dollars. Award will be made to the lowest price technically acceptable quote based on technical acceptability, price, and past performance. Interested offerors must maintain an active SAM record and provide their UEI and CAGE code. The submission deadline was extended via Amendment 0001 to September 21, 2026. Payments will be processed electronically through the Wide Area WorkFlow system. Access to the military installation for performance or the scheduled site visit requires strict adherence to base access and vetting requirements, including background checks and identity verification.

This contract involves the provision, laundering, and management of staff uniforms and badges that adhere strictly to NIH access and identification protocols. It is a subcontract opportunity under an 8(a) competed set-aside, indicating it is specifically targeted to businesses participating in the Small Business Administration’s 8(a) Business Development program. The contract supports the National Institutes of Health through the Department of Health and Human Services, focusing on ensuring that all personnel uniforms and badges meet regulatory standards for access control and professional appearance. The work will be performed primarily in Durham, with a postal code of 27709, reflecting a localized point of performance for services. The solicitation does not have a specified solicitation number but was posted on May 19, 2026, with a response deadline set for June 18, 2026, at 6:00 PM. The NAICS code assigned is 812320, which corresponds to drycleaning and laundry services, aligning with the laundry aspect of the contract.
